Breathing to Lifting XUV700, it is expected that it will arrive with a lot of new features and a design update. In these recent spy shots, we can see the Mahindra XUV700 restyling test mule is completely camouflaged and hides the design changes. At least most of them. We can identify a new front grill that establishes an aggressive charm.
The headlights could be a temporary improvisation solution while the mules of future tests present present elements aimed. These circular LED LED projectors can be taken by Thar Roxx and will not reach the final version. The front bumper could also obtain an update to establish a visual distinction.



In this particular test mule, there are no changes in its lateral profile and in the rear section. Continue with the same design as the alloy wheel and the rear lights. This suggests that Mahindra can implement changes only to the band or future test mules could pack more changes to lateral and rear design, with inspiration from XEV 7E.
Triple screen dashboard
Inside, the Mahindra XUV700 lifting is identified with a triple configuration on the screen on this particular test mule. It could be the same implementation of the 10.2 -inch triple screen that we experienced for the first time in Xev 9e. The rival brands are also presenting triple screen configurations, in particular the nanny Sierra.



In addition to the triple screen configuration, we want Mahindra XUV700 obtains some missing features such as rear ventilated seats, rear wireless charging pad, an Irvm Auto-Bighellone, self-challenging features, digital key, Ottoman fueled for rear occupants, dedicated climatic zone for the occupants of the second line and more.



The power supply of the Mahindra XUV700 lifting will be the same set of engines as the current 2.0-liter turbo turbello model and a 2.2-liter turbo diesel engine, combined with a 6-speed manual or an automatic 6-speed torque converter automatic transmission. Mahindra will likely maintain the AWD option with automatic diesel even in higher finishes. The launch could happen in 2026.
